Foote puts hands on Golf Classic trophy

DR Andre Foote with 41 points overcame an over-subscribed field of 96 golfers to be named the overall winner of the Columbus Business Solutions/AMCHAM Golf Classic on Sunday at the Caymanas Golf Club in St Catherine.

“I feel very good cause I have been playing with my club, the Buccaneer Golf Club, and I want to dedicate this victory to them… it was very good out there. I putted well and I am glad I was victorious,” said Foote, who won for himself two airline tickets courtesy of Jet Blue from Kingston to New York.

Marvin Mendes with 40 points won the Men’s Under-50 category and he walked away with a weekend for two at Secrets Resort in Montego Bay. Second and third went to Larry Lodengai and Bert Tomlinson with 39 and 38 points, respectively.

In the Men’s Over-50 category, Dr Soe Win won with 40 points, and for his efforts, he received a weekend for two at Half Moon Resort. Chris Cruz, 39, came second with Vikram Dhiman, 37 points, in third place.

Tiana Cruz copped the Ladies trophy with 37 points with a better back nine, and she got a weekend for two courtesy of Couples, Tower Isle. Kai Harris, 37, was second and Rowena Coe, 32, copped third. Last year’s overall winner Spanish Ambassador Celsa Nuno, 32, came in fourth.

Scientific Medical Supplies won the Corporate category with team members Dr Soe Win, Tony Wong, Howard Lau and Khaleel Azan.

The final category — the Juniors — went to Jordan Lowe.

Dr Karl Bruce, 76, won the prize for the best gross score and claimed a weekend for two at Jewels.

David Mais, the tournament director, said the tournament was very successful based on the high number of entries. “The managers at Caymanas has done a great job preparing the golf course and it showed in the excellent results,” he said.
